A heavily pregnant woman in Upper Iweka road on Tuesday, January 26th, gave birth to a baby girl in the FRSC van in Onitsha, the commercial city of Anambra State.
It was learnt that officials of the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C) reported that the unidentified woman went into labor and gave birth to a baby girl in their vehicle on the way to Toronto hospital.
However, it’s still unclear where exactly the baby was born, as the photos accompanying the story show the woman and the girl lying in a drainage system. "We give all the glory to God," FRSC members wrote.
